For some years now, during the summer months, we are visited by Tawny Frogmouths, which spend a good part of their daylight hours sleeping. When they are awake through the day, they can be seen stretching and sometimes changing branches to get more comfortable. On wet days, they can be seen snuggling up to each other trying to keep warm. We have a Giant Strelitzia in the garden, and when it rains, the tawnies are usually under the shelter of its large leaves and fairly dry... very clever of them!


With this layout, I have used several green-toned papers, torn them. distressed the edges and inked. I've added hand-painted leaves (gessoed cardstock, sprayed, added acrylics and distress stains) and a chipboard tree. Hidden journalling has been held in place with a brad.
